- from argparse import ArgumentParser, Namespace
- import sys
- import os
- class GroupParams:
- pass
- class ParamGroup:
- def __init__(self, parser: ArgumentParser, name : str, fill_none = False):
- group = parser.add_argument_group(name)
- for key, value in vars(self).items():
- shorthand = False
- if key.startswith("_"):
- shorthand = True
- key = key[1:]
- t = type(value)
- value = value if not fill_none else None
- if shorthand:
- if t == bool:
- group.add_argument("--" + key, ("-" + key[0:1]), default=value, action="store_true")
- else:
- group.add_argument("--" + key, ("-" + key[0:1]), default=value, type=t)
- else:
- if t == bool:
- group.add_argument("--" + key, default=value, action="store_true")
- else:
- group.add_argument("--" + key, default=value, type=t)
- def extract(self, args):
- group = GroupParams()
- for arg in vars(args).items():
- if arg[0] in vars(self) or ("_" + arg[0]) in vars(self):
- setattr(group, arg[0], arg[1])
- return group
- class ModelParams(ParamGroup):
- def __init__(self, parser, sentinel=False):
- self.sh_degree = 3
- self._source_path = ""
- self._model_path = ""
- self._images = "images"
- self._resolution = 1
- self._white_background = False
- self.eval = False
- super().__init__(parser, "Loading Parameters", sentinel)
- class PipelineParams(ParamGroup):
- def __init__(self, parser):
- self.convert_SHs_python = False
- self.compute_cov3D_python = False
- super().__init__(parser, "Pipeline Parameters")
- class OptimizationParams(ParamGroup):
- def __init__(self, parser):
- self.iterations = 30_000
- self.position_lr_init = 0.00016
- self.position_lr_final = 0.0000016
- self.position_lr_delay_mult = 0.01
- self.posititon_lr_max_steps = 30_000
- self.feature_lr = 0.0025
- self.opacity_lr = 0.05
- self.scaling_lr = 0.001
- self.rotation_lr = 0.001
- self.percent_dense = 0.01
- self.lambda_dssim = 0.2
- self.densification_interval = 100
- self.opacity_reset_interval = 3000
- self.densify_from_iter = 500
- self.densify_until_iter = 15_000
- self.densify_grad_threshold = 0.0002
- super().__init__(parser, "Optimization Parameters")
- def get_combined_args(parser : ArgumentParser):
- cmdlne_string = sys.argv[1:]
- cfgfile_string = "Namespace()"
- args_cmdline = parser.parse_args(cmdlne_string)
- try:
- cfgfilepath = os.path.join(args_cmdline.model_path, "cfg_args")
- print("Looking for config file in", cfgfilepath)
- with open(cfgfilepath) as cfg_file:
- print("Config file found: {}".format(cfgfilepath))
- cfgfile_string = cfg_file.read()
- except TypeError:
- print("Config file not found at")
- pass
- args_cfgfile = eval(cfgfile_string)
- merged_dict = vars(args_cfgfile).copy()
- for k,v in vars(args_cmdline).items():
- if v != None:
- merged_dict[k] = v
- return Namespace(**merged_dict)
